The Athletic is reporting that Troy university located in Alabama has fired its head coach. They listed Lance Taylor as one of the 6 candidates for the job:

Notre Dame run game coordinator/running backs coach Lance Taylor grew up in the state and was in on the South Alabama head coaching job last year. He’s produced a lot of talent, from Christian McCaffrey to Bryce Love to Kyren Williams, and he figures to get a close look at this job.

I could see the Troy job being of interest to Taylor. Troy is a member of the Sun Belt conference which, after the latest conference realignment that took place this summer, many think has a chance to become the top Group of Five conferences in the country. This Troy job might just be appealing to a guy who grew up in Alabama.
